Woman wants scan to check for PIP leakage

by isleofman.com 19th January 2012

A local woman who has PIP breast implants is urging the Manx government to put pressure on the private clinic which fitted them.

Michelle, who lives in Douglas, is the third woman to have contacted Manx Radio about the health scare in the past week.

There are fears the now-banned implants could rupture, after were they were filled with industrial rather than medical grade silicone.

Some clinics have blamed poor regulation for the use of the material and say they cannot afford to remove them.

Michelle is calling on the Harley Medical Group, which carried out her cosmetic surgery, to face up to its moral responsibility and replace the implants free of charge:
